Protein crystallography data

The structure of Crystal Structure of Haloalkane Dehalogenase LINB32 Mutant (L177W) From Sphingobium Japonicum UT26, PDB code: 4wdq was solved by O.Degtjarik, P.Rezacova, R.Chaloupkova, J.Damborsky, I.Kuta-Smatanova,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 40.49 / 1.58
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 46.729, 68.490, 81.055, 90.00, 90.00, 90.00
R / Rfree (%) 16 / 20.6
